为什么学编程孩子格外优秀
-
学编程的孩子之所以格外优秀,主要有以下几个原因:
首先,学编程可以培养孩子的逻辑思维能力。编程是一门需要严谨的思维和逻辑推理的学科。在学习编程的过程中,孩子需要学会分析问题、拆解问题、寻找解决方案,并将其转化为计算机可以理解和执行的代码。这个过程能够锻炼孩子的逻辑思维能力,使其能够清晰地思考问题、分析问题,并能够快速找到问题的解决方法。
其次,学编程可以培养孩子的创造力和创新思维。编程是一个创造性的过程,通过编写代码创造出新的程序和应用。在编程的过程中,孩子需要不断地思考如何用最简洁、高效的方式解决问题,需要不断地尝试新的方法和思路。这样的训练能够培养孩子的创造力和创新思维,使其在解决问题和创造新的东西时更加有想象力和创意。
再次,学编程可以培养孩子的耐心和坚持能力。编程是一个需要反复尝试和调试的过程,有时候一个小错误可能导致整个程序无法正常运行。在学习编程的过程中,孩子需要不断地调试和修复代码,需要耐心地找到错误,并坚持不懈地改正。通过这样的过程,孩子能够培养出耐心和坚持的品质,不怕困难,勇于迎接挑战。
最后,学编程可以培养孩子的合作与沟通能力。在真实的编程工作中,很少有人能够独立完成所有的任务,通常需要与其他人合作。学习编程的过程中,孩子常常需要和同伴一起解决问题、讨论思路,并协同完成项目。这样的训练能够培养孩子的合作与沟通能力,使其能够与他人合作,共同完成任务。
综上所述,学编程的孩子之所以格外优秀,是因为学习编程能够培养他们的逻辑思维能力、创造力和创新思维、耐心和坚持能力,以及合作与沟通能力。这些优秀的品质将使他们在学习和工作中更加出色,并为他们的未来发展打下坚实的基础。
1年前 -
学编程的孩子格外优秀的原因有很多,以下是其中的五个主要原因:
-
提高逻辑思维能力:编程是一门需要逻辑思维的学科,通过学习编程,孩子们可以培养自己的逻辑思维能力。编程需要将问题进行拆解、分析和解决,这个过程需要思考和推理,培养了孩子们的逻辑思维能力。逻辑思维能力不仅在编程中有用,还可以应用到其他学科和生活中。
-
培养解决问题的能力:编程是一种解决问题的方法论。学习编程可以教会孩子们如何分析和解决问题。在编程过程中,孩子们需要找到问题的核心,确定解决方案,并逐步实施。这种解决问题的能力不仅在编程中有用,还可以应用到其他领域,帮助孩子们更好地应对挑战和困难。
-
增强创造力和创新意识:编程是一门创造性的学科。通过编程,孩子们可以创造出自己想要的程序和应用。编程可以激发孩子们的创造力和创新意识,让他们不断尝试新的想法和方法,培养他们的创造性思维和创新能力。
-
培养团队合作和沟通能力:编程往往需要团队合作,特别是在大型项目中。通过与其他人合作,孩子们可以学习如何与他人合作,分工合作,共同解决问题。此外,编程还需要与计算机进行沟通,孩子们需要清晰地表达自己的想法和意图。通过编程,孩子们可以培养团队合作和沟通能力,这对他们未来的职业生涯和社交能力都非常重要。
-
增强问题分析和抽象能力:编程需要将现实世界的问题进行抽象和转化,然后用计算机语言来解决。这个过程培养了孩子们的问题分析和抽象能力。孩子们需要学会将复杂的问题简化为更小的模块,然后一步步解决。这种问题分析和抽象能力对于解决其他学科和生活中的问题也非常有帮助。
总之,学编程的孩子们格外优秀是因为编程培养了他们的逻辑思维能力、解决问题的能力、创造力和创新意识、团队合作和沟通能力,以及问题分析和抽象能力。这些能力对于孩子们的学习和未来的发展都有很大的帮助。
1年前 -
-
学习编程对孩子的发展具有许多益处,因此很多孩子在学习编程后表现出格外的优秀。下面从几个方面来解释这个问题。
-
提高逻辑思维能力
编程是一种逻辑思维的活动,它要求孩子在解决问题时进行思考、分析和推理。通过编程,孩子们需要学会将问题分解成小的可管理的部分,然后逐步解决每个部分,最终完成整个程序。这种思维方式培养了孩子们的逻辑思维能力,使他们在解决问题和处理信息时更加敏捷和准确。 -
培养创造力和创新意识
编程是一门创造性的活动,通过编程,孩子们可以创造出自己的程序和应用。他们可以根据自己的想法和需求设计和开发各种有趣和实用的应用程序,这培养了他们的创造力和创新意识。编程还可以激发孩子们的想象力,使他们能够将自己的想法和概念转化为现实。 -
培养问题解决能力
编程过程中经常会遇到各种问题和挑战,孩子们需要学会通过分析和解决问题来完成任务。这种问题解决能力对孩子们的学习和生活都有很大的帮助。在编程中,孩子们需要学会寻找问题的根源、分析问题的原因,并找到解决问题的方法。这种能力培养了他们的逻辑思维和分析能力,使他们在面对各种问题时更加自信和有效。 -
培养耐心和毅力
编程是一项需要耐心和毅力的工作。在编程过程中,孩子们需要反复尝试和调试代码,直到达到预期的结果。这个过程中可能会遇到各种困难和挫折,但是只要他们坚持下去,最终会取得成功。通过编程,孩子们学会了坚持不懈地解决问题,培养了他们的耐心和毅力。 -
培养团队合作能力
编程不仅可以个人完成,还可以通过团队合作来完成更复杂的项目。在团队合作中,孩子们需要学会与他人沟通、协调和合作,共同解决问题。这培养了孩子们的团队合作能力和沟通能力,使他们能够与他人合作并取得共同的目标。
总之,学习编程可以培养孩子们的逻辑思维能力、创造力、问题解决能力、耐心和毅力,以及团队合作能力。这些优势使得学习编程的孩子们在学习和生活中表现出格外的优秀。
1年前 -